只有开放式API地理数据库编写器可以在FME服务器/云上使用。这不允许您公开“geodb-type”和“geodb-metadata-string”格式属性。
是否有人知道将元数据写入地理数据库的解决方案?如果不是,这似乎是服务器/云的一个主要缺点。
我在找其他可能经历过类似经历的人。我周一回到办公室,发现FME云上的ftpwatcher刚刚检测到我们的ftp服务器上的所有文件都是新创建的……这导致了很多工作区运行……
我怀疑FTP服务器本身一定发生了什么事,然而,我看不到可能发生的任何事情。当使用filezilla查看文件时,所有文件的日期和时间似乎都是正确的。
ftpwathch.log中有一个片段,似乎就在所有新触发之前。上面没有时间戳,不幸的是。
it.sauronsoftware.ftp4j.ftpexception[代码=550,Souron StudioStudio.ftp4j.ftpclit.Listurn.ftp4j.ftpclie.SournStudio.ftp4j.ftpclie.com(ftpCopy.java:2273)在com .FaseRever .Tele.Puxin .ftpWist.ftpCavePurcult.thord.Fr亚搏在线uteFieleFun.FiMeServer .Tele.Puxin .ftpCopePuleTyth.R.Purf.FutsFieldField.FraceFiel.Time.java:342).在COM.Field.FiMeServer .FielServ.Tele.Puxin .ftpWist.ftpCavePraceTyth.No.Poice(FTpCaveReopyTyth.java:165)在COM.Fabel.FMESMERVER .Tele.Puulin .ftpWeCurnField.Tr.Run(FTPTWAKEPOLIN线程.java:102)上轮询
在谷歌的“数据通道超时”上,防火墙似乎是一个常见的原因,然而,我看不出这有什么关系。
有人对此有什么见解吗?
我们的FME服务器版本是17725。上次重新启动实例是在星期四,就在这件事发生的前几天。
在接下来的几个月里,我们将从Linux上的一个FME云实例(2018.1)迁移到Windows Server 2016,我还没有找到任何关于正确迁移方式的信息。在我们尝试之前,试着制定一个游戏计划。在执行迁移时,我们仍将运行FME云实例。FME云备份是否与Windows服务器平台上的FME服务器一起工作?
如果有人能给我指明正确的方向,或者有任何有用的链接,那将是非常感谢的。我能找到的只是从FME服务器迁移到FME云信息,所以我不确定用不同的操作系统来做这件事会遇到什么障碍。
现在在桌面、服务器和云计算中对Azure/S3+++有一些支持。那么,将rclone作为后端工具来支持对“所有云存储”的读写呢?
https://rclone.org网站/
它似乎是云存储读/写的“FME”——支持以下技术:
https://rclone.org网站/
你好,
我创建了一个工作区,用HTTP调用者在Web API上创建文件夹并上载文件。
第一个版本在一个级别上创建文件夹,然后上载文件。然后它继续做下一个层次,以此类推。所以它基本上是一系列HTTPCaller,在桌面和云上都工作得很好。
但是,由于不可能知道提前有多少文件夹级别,所以我用一个自定义循环转换器和一个HTTP调用者实现了它。
这在桌面上工作得更好,但尝试在FME云上运行它似乎永远也做不到。
在云上运行半小时后,桌面上需要8秒钟的时间还没有准备好……似乎永远不会准备好。
我检查了WebConnection,并将自定义转换器上载到存储库和Transformers文件夹。我运行的是同一版本的桌面和云2018.1.0.1(18528)。它最初不接受早期云版本上的自定义转换器。
对我想检查的内容或有类似问题的人有什么想法吗?
谢谢!
雅各伯
你好,
我在Azure市场上看不到FME服务器。你能告诉我如何在Azure上部署FME服务器的“指南”和/或“食谱”资源吗?我们已经部署了SQL Server,但目前还不确定该SQL是否是iaas或paas。
谢谢,鲍勃
FME服务器2018.1-构建18520-Linux-X64(在FME云上)
工作区加载了FME桌面2018.1.0.1(20180730-内部版本18528-Win64)
python兼容性脚本:pyton 3.4+
对这个问题的阐述方式表示歉意,但我真的不知道FME服务器中的这个错误来自何处以及如何描述它(我在Google上搜索了它,似乎找不到任何参考)。
它是不相容的,它出现在工作区执行中,并且作业失败(在结尾处),但是如果作业重新运行(相同的工作区),则一切正常,然后它可能再次出现和消失。
它出现在既没有任何python转换器也没有启动关闭脚本的工作区中。
有人能帮忙吗?
谢谢
我正在尝试连接到Oracle云以获得人力资源和财务管理服务。到目前为止,我没有任何运气。有人能建立这些连接吗?如果我们可以连接到现有的EIS报告,这将是一个很好的解决办法,但据我所知,我们不能让EIS报告自动加载到一个FTP站点,在那里我们可以获取它们。
我们目前正在使用FME 2017,但如果需要新版本,我们可以进行升级。任何建议或帮助都会非常感谢。
我们最近向FME云警报添加了一个新警报。这个无响应服务器警觉的:
你好,
我很难理解FME云和FME服务器之间的区别。
主要我想使用RESTAPI通过Web表单与FME云交互,但是我似乎无法100%地工作。
我试图在演示页面上复制一些上传示例,但似乎我遗漏了一些东西。https://playground.fmeserver.com/demos/
使用FME云运行大量的短作业对于服务器的运行时间来说是非常昂贵的。
例如,如果需要运行每天运行5分钟的翻译,你会被收费很多服务器时间没有使用。
AWS最近允许以不到一小时的时间间隔在更新的Linux上计费。如果计费时间不到一个小时,那么在FME亚搏在线云上,它将使一些工作流变得非常经济。
基于此知识库问题:
https://knowledge.亚搏在线safe.com/questions/37275/fme-cloud-pricing.html网站
我正在尝试解决为什么云工作区不使用数据运行的问题,我正在从服务器获取此响应。
“request”:“\”数据处理/fielddatalinecreator/fielddatalinecreator.fmw\“-xml\参数\远程地址\”127.0.0.1\“,\”主机\“:\”生产tgs.fmcloud.com\“,\”用户代理\“:\”mozilla/5.0(Windows NT 10.0;Win 64;X64;RV:59.0)gecko/20100101 firefox/59.0“C:\\fakepath\\1801116-012618rf(tgs_export_v2)csvhtps://production-tgs.fmecloud.com/fmedatadownload/dataprocessing/fielddatalinecreator.fmw?详细信息=高\“opt-u-resresresformat\”:\“json\”,\“sourcdata集\u csv2\”:\“c:\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\ \“opt-showresult\”:\“true\”,\“toke \”、\“\\\\\\“json\”,“json\”,“sourcdata集\ \ u csv2\”:\“c:\ \ \ \ \ \ \ \ \ \ \ \”c:\ \ \ \ \ \ \ \ \ \ \ \ \ \ \“本地主机”--fme“服务器”端口“7071”--fme“服务器”eb_url“https://production tgs.fmecloud.com\”-acad_1_dataset\“!FME_auto_dir_name!.zip/已处理.dwg\“”,
这是我认为错误的请求的一部分。
C:\\fakepath\\1801116-012618rf(tgs_export_v2)csvhtps://production-tgs.fmecloud.com/fmedatadownload/dataprocessing/fielddatalinecreator.fmw?
我在服务器的工作区中收到这个失败消息。
csv reader:无法打开文件“c:\fakepath\1801116-012618rf(tgs_export_v2).csv”进行读取。请确保该文件存在,并且您有足够的权限读取它。
我试图通过通知服务向来自电子邮件的工作提交者添加文件引用。电子邮件就在这里:
资源/系统/temp/emailattachments/2018032301138-tgsdata@production-tgs.fmecloud.com-test/autocad.dwg
我以前使用过电子邮件附件,当它们进入到$fm sharedesource/$fm jod id
我使用我想要的文件的完整路径尝试ftpcaller,但是我不确定身份验证,因为它似乎没有文档。我不能使用用户名和密码,必须使用ssh密钥文件。设置ssh代理似乎是一种方法,但是如何选择密钥文件?我正以任何方式发布到云端,所以我想我会看看那里有什么,似乎有使用订户和ftp观察者(没有sftp)的sftp上传功能。我错过什么了吗?
FME云提供了一套很好的工具,允许用户根据可能影响FME云实例正常运行时间和性能的特定条件轻松设置警报。但在我们能做到之前创建警报和配置通知 我们需要了解警报所基于的指标。当创建警报或在实例页上的监视选项卡下选择实例时,这些指标可见。
FME服务器的内存消耗很大程度上取决于底层工作空间和使用的变压器。内存使用度量是查看FME云实例是否有问题的第一个度量。内存不足是导致失效的FME云实例最常见的原因之一。某些作业可能会突然失败,日志文件可能没有您要查找的信息。该指标还可以帮助调查作业失败情况。在查看内存使用情况时要记住的一点是,当内存不足时,可能还需要检查临时磁盘使用情况。当实例内存不足时,一些转换将写入临时磁盘。
主磁盘包含FME服务器安装,发布到FME服务器和PostgreSQL数据库的数据。我们绝对建议密切关注这个指标,并针对主要磁盘使用情况设置警报。当主磁盘已满时,即使在实例重新启动之后,Web应用程序服务器也可能会关闭并无法正确启动。通常恢复的唯一方法是回滚到以前的备份。这就是为什么主磁盘使用率警报(超过10分钟的90%使用率)是一个非常重要的警报,并且默认情况下为所有实例启用。另一个防止磁盘空间耗尽的非常有用的工具是FME服务器系统清理.
此磁盘映射到FME服务器上的临时资源文件夹。当实例暂停且未备份时,它将被擦除。当实例内存不足并开始写出临时数据时,这种临时磁盘使用率也会增加。当临时磁盘使用中出现异常模式时,建议始终检查内存使用情况。一定要检查这个关于临时磁盘的文章.
可以通过FME服务器的Web用户界面设置FME服务器引擎计数。比最初设置的发动机计数高可能有不同的原因。根据您的工作流程,亚搏在线使用fmeserverjobsubmitter可以通过作业启动其他引擎。如果出现更高数量的引擎,那么您将在度量中看到,可能有问题。如果有发动机启动和不再关闭的模式,请特别注意。你需要调查这个问题。如果需要恒定的引擎计数,设置警报以在指标更改时立即通知非常有用。
网络吞吐量度量允许您以每秒千字节为单位监视FME云实例的输入和输出。如果您在FME上实现了一个允许客户上传和下载数据的解决方案,这对于检测任何异常行为都非常有用。
该指标指向FME服务器健康检查页面。较高的数字可能表示服务器负载过重,对请求的响应速度比平时慢。如果您在10分钟或更长时间内遇到超过500 ms的响应时间,您应该查看实例并检查其他指标,如服务器负载或内存,以查看实例是否在挣扎。
高服务器负载通常与高内存利用率结合在一起。也,你运行的引擎越多,服务器负载越高。要正确解释服务器负载并为警报设置足够的阈值,了解服务器负载度量及其对FME云实例核心数量的影响是很重要的。1.0的负载意味着1个核心的100%利用率。我们的FME Cloud Starter实例有两个核心,因此负载为2.0表示这两个核心得到了充分利用。因此,假设您最近在标准大小的实例(4核和16 GB RAM)上增加了引擎,并希望确保您的FME云实例能够处理它。在这种情况下,应将警报设置为当负载超过2.8时触发。相当于4核70%的利用率,超过30分钟。